H
Helen Huang Review of Godochurch
The services provided by Godochurch are average. I...
The services provided by Godochurch are average. I think they can improve in terms of their customer service. My overall experience was okay. The website godochurch.com is user-friendly. They have a good range of products and services.
Comments: